Marco Borriello, back from loan, is ready to make an impact.
AC Milan has ended their horrible early season form with three consecutive wins, starting with Lazio(4-1) and continuing with the reigning champions, Inter. Milan has utilized their Brazilian connection to their fullest extent, along with Marco Borrielo. The deadly combination of Borrielo and Alexandre Pato has also proven to be effective. Ronaldinho, who has been heavily criticized during this stage in his career, has also been in good form. He just scored his first goal for AC Milan against Inter, which turned out to be the only goal of the match. Currently, AC Milan are just three points from being in the top spot, which is currently held by Lazio. The other big clubs, excluding Inter (ahead by one point) , are either tied (Juventus) or behind (Roma, Fiorentina) AC Milan. Inter Milan picked up their 5th draw today against Udinese Calcio. It was a scoreless draw. In the 21st minute midfielder Aparecido Cesar received a red card. Neither team could get the valuable three points, but they would have to settle with one point each.

Brazilian Alexandre Pato cooled down the red hot Genoa. The game was at Genoa’s home stadium, the Stadio Guiseppe Meazza. Pato, the new Milan sensation headed a ball in, during the 65 minute. The home side’s (Genoa) task was made more difficult when Goalkeeper, Rubinho was red-carded. Rubinho had handled the ball outside the area. Milan wasn’t finished. They struck again in the 82 minute, with Pato’s first attempt being blocked. The second attempt was scored.
Roma is keeping the pressure on the Serie A leaders, Inter Milan, after yesterday’s routine win against Palermo. Roma went into this encounter chasing the title. Alessandro Mancini scored in the 59 minute. It was a great way for Roma to keep Inter on their toes.
